Arctostaphylos emerald carpet emerald carpet manzanita evergreen groundcover like shrub 8 14 inches tall and about 5 ft wide.
Very compact and dense plant with small glossy deep green leaves that nearly hide the attractive cinnamon red stems with exfoliating reddish black bark.

This is a hybrid between arctostaphylos uva ursi and arctostaphylos nummularia.
